Computer Software Engineer salary in Thailand

Average Yearly Salary of Computer Software Engineer in Thailand is approximately 449,115 THB (11,239 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Computer Software Engineer do?

occupation personasA computer software engineer is a professional respon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ining software systems. They analyze user requirements, design software solutions, write code, and test and debug applications. They work closely with other team members, such as software developers and project managers, to ensure that software projects are delivered on time and meet the specified requirements. Computer software engineers typically have a strong background in programming languages, algorithms, and data structures. They possess excellent problem-solving skills and have a deep understanding of software development principles and practices. They stay up-to-date with the latest technologies and trends in the industry to continuously improve their skills and knowledge.

Salary comparison to National average

Thailand, officially known as the Kingdom of Thailand, is a Southeast Asian country located in the Indochinese Peninsula. It has a population of approximately 69 million people and covers an area of around 513,120 square kilometers.

Estimated national average yearly salary is 265,486 THB (7,230 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Computer Software Engineer job salary compared to average salary in Thailand.
Comparison shows that a person working as Computer Software Engineer in Thailand earns on average:
1.69 times the average salary (or 169% of average salary).

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ary. The salary increase over years of experience can vary widely based on factors such as job industry, job role, location, company size, and individual performance.
